Analysis

In 2024, ammonia, anhydrous — import value in Hungary stood at 15,752 1000 USD. That is the highest value across all 23 years on record.

That represents a change of up 2,378.8% on the previous year and up 689.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, ammonia, anhydrous — import value in Hungary peaked at 15,752 1000 USD in 2024 and was at its lowest, 22 1000 USD, in 2006.

Hungary ranks 38th of 189 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

The Fertilizers by Product dataset contains information on the Production, Trade and Agriculture Use of inorganic (chemical or mineral) fertilizers products. The fertilizer statistics data are for a set of 23 product categories. Both straight and compound fertilizers are included.
